The invention relates to rare earth machining equipment, in particular to an efficient configuration device for a rare earth element extraction agent for rare earth machining. According to the technical purposes to be achieved, the efficient configuration device for the rare earth element extraction agent for rare earth machining is provided, wherein configuration can be rapidly conducted, and time and labor are saved in the configuration and stirring process. In order to achieve the above technical purposes, the efficient configuration device for the rare earth element extraction agent for rare earth machining is provided and comprises a bottom plate, a first fixing plate, a connecting rod, a second fixing plate, a stirring box, a liquid discharging pipe, a second valve, a bearing block, a rotating rod, a sealing ring, a stirring blade and the like. The first fixing plate is installed at the middle portion of the upper side of the bottom plate in a welding manner, the connecting rod is installed at the left end of the first fixing plate in a welding manner, and the second fixing plate is installed above the right side of the connecting rod in a welding manner. The efficient configuration device for the rare earth element extraction agent for rare earth machining has the beneficial effects that configuration can be rapidly conducted, and time and labor are saved in the configuration and stirring process.
